CoreWeave is not a conventional cloud provider. It is a compute underwriter. The model works in sequence: secure multi-year, prepaid contracts with frontier AI labs; borrow capital against those contracts; purchase NVIDIA GPUs at allocation-grade volume; then build data centers around committed revenue streams. Microsoft's multi-billion-dollar pact validated this blueprint. OpenAI followed. The company's 2025 public listing hinged on this structure. Indonesia, within that framework, is a strange coordinate. Japan offers advanced grid infrastructure. Korea has semiconductor depth. Singapore is the regional financial hub — but Singapore froze new data center approvals in 2019. Japan and Korea carry premium energy costs. Indonesia offers land, labor, and electricity at regional discounts, plus something increasingly valuable: a data-localization regime that forces foreign operators to maintain physical presence. Jakarta has tightened its electronic-system registration rules for years. A dedicated GPU cloud node inside the country satisfies compliance obligations and positions CoreWeave for Southeast Asia's institutional AI demand in a single move. Indonesia's own AI ambitions complicate the picture further: the government has announced national language-model development plans and sovereign cloud infrastructure targets. Foreign GPU capacity inside the country becomes both a supply source and a political dependency. That dual role will shape every negotiation ahead. Regional AI cloud supply remains thin. Most Southeast Asian enterprises still route training workloads through US or Chinese facilities. CoreWeave's presence intends to change that calculus — if the economics close.
The anchor client question comes first. CoreWeave does not build speculative capacity. Its debt covenants, equipment financing, and GPU purchase obligations all assume long-dated leases with creditworthy counterparties. An unanchored CoreWeave facility is structurally improbable. The announcement's silence on customers means one of two things: the prospective tenant is bound by confidentiality, or no final contract exists yet. Both outcomes carry radically different implications. Treat the missing client name as the most important data point in this release. The GPU supply chain constraint follows. High-bandwidth memory, not chip design, is the binding layer of the current AI stack. NVIDIA's allocation strategy has become geopolitical policy in all but name. CoreWeave's supply advantage derives from a structural fact — NVIDIA holds equity in the company. That relationship does not automatically extend to Indonesian facilities. Export controls, allocation priorities, and power delivery constraints shift quarterly. A data center announcement is not a GPU procurement announcement. The gap between those two events is where execution risk compounds. Competitive positioning needs calibration. AWS operates a Jakarta region. Microsoft maintains Asia-Pacific infrastructure. Alibaba Cloud has Indonesian presence and a decade of localization experience. But none of them is a professional AI-cloud specialist in the CoreWeave sense — bare-metal GPU clusters, ultra-high-speed interconnect, flexible long-duration contracts. This is a vertical-slice attack, not a full-stack war. The vulnerability is complementarity. Local enterprises demand identity management, database services, object storage, and compliance tooling. A GPU-only node requires partners for those layers. The stronger regional hyperscaler ecosystems grow, the thinner CoreWeave's standalone value proposition becomes. Its moat is NVIDIA supply. Its gap is everything else.
Financial engineering is the fourth layer. Projects of this class require billions in capital expenditure. CoreWeave's balance sheet already carries substantial debt from previous expansions. The industry-standard mechanism for managing this load is structural isolation: sale-leaseback arrangements, joint-venture vehicles, or project-finance subsidiaries that keep the Indonesian asset off the consolidated income statement. Sovereign wealth funds and infrastructure investors routinely participate in Southeast Asian data center projects. The announcement's silence on financing suggests the structure is either incomplete or deliberately opaque. "Growth signal" is the generous read. "Balance-sheet management" is the structural one.

Regulatory execution is the fifth layer, and the one most often underestimated by foreign entrants. Indonesia restricts foreign ownership in digital infrastructure categories. Electronic-system operator registration carries compliance obligations that extend beyond the data center itself. Data localization rules add another constraint: designated categories of citizen data must remain inside Indonesian jurisdiction. CoreWeave will almost certainly need a local partner — a joint-venture vehicle, a nominee shareholder, or a build-to-suit landlord. None of those structures is economically neutral. Each one changes the project's cost basis, repatriation paths, and control profile.
Then there is the construction timeline. Indonesian data center projects of this class typically require 12 to 24 months from groundbreaking to first customer load. That means no material revenue contribution before late 2026 or 2027 — assuming permitting, grid connection, and GPU delivery all proceed without delay. Those are three very large assumptions in a jurisdiction where land certificates, foreign ownership limits, and power purchase agreements each carry their own approval cycles.
Here is the angle no one is covering: Indonesia might not be the customer base at all. The facility could function as a low-cost, low-latency compute node serving Singapore and Australia — two markets with deep AI capital but severe physical constraints. This reframes the entire announcement. It is not a bet on Indonesian adoption. It is geographic arbitrage. Watch the partnership structure as the quiet tell: no local co-investor has been named, which either means negotiations are active or this is a feasibility exercise dressed as an announcement. Then there is the carbon dimension. Indonesia's grid remains coal-heavy. A large-scale GPU facility in that energy mix produces an emissions footprint that complicates the green-AI narrative institutional clients increasingly demand. The announcement does not mention energy sources. That silence will not age well. And beneath both layers sits a geopolitical one: an American AI-cloud operator planting infrastructure in a region where Chinese technology firms are actively expanding. This is not just market competition. It is infrastructure competition between two computing standards. Read every subsequent regulatory filing through that lens.
